Musée archéologique Arkéos, Archaeological museum in Douai, France
Arkéos is an archaeological museum in Douai that presents finds from the early Stone Age through the medieval period. The exhibits are organized in chronological sections showing objects and tools from various periods of human settlement in the region.
The museum opened in 2014 and houses important discoveries including ancient stone tools and skull fragments dating back over 180,000 years. These findings demonstrate that humans have inhabited this area for an extremely long time.
The collection displays artifacts from a medieval abbey as well as objects recovered through decades of excavations in the city. Visitors can see how people lived and worked across different periods in this region.
The museum is open daily except Tuesdays, with longer hours during warmer months and shorter hours in the colder season. Allow one to two hours to comfortably explore the exhibits and read the information provided.
An adjoining archaeological park displays reconstructed medieval buildings and a traditional tavern, allowing visitors to experience how people lived and gathered in past times. The park offers a hands-on way to understand daily life during the medieval period.

Flanders in Belgium is a region with a rich history stretching back centuries. Visitors find medieval town centers, old castles, cathedrals, and museums that tell stories of trade, art, and craftsmanship. Cities like Bruges, Ghent, and Antwerp display the architecture and culture of earlier times, while smaller towns like Damme and Veurne preserve the character of the past. In Bruges, visitors can walk through narrow streets, relax by the canals, and taste Belgian beer in traditional breweries. Ghent stands out for its Graslei waterfront and the imposing Castle of the Counts of Flanders. Antwerp offers a town hall on the Grand-Place, a respected diamond museum, and the Rubenshuis, the home of painter Peter Paul Rubens. Along the coast, visitors find beach towns like Blankenberge and Knokke-Heist, a nostalgic tram, and nature reserves. Inland, there are war museums in Ieper, chocolate museums in several cities, and specialized collections like the harp museum. Fishermen in Oostduinkerke preserve traditional methods, while parks and nature areas offer space to explore.
